Park Saeroyi’s life is shattered after an incident with a powerful corporate heir leads to his expulsion and imprisonment. Instead of breaking, he crafts a 15-year plan to take down Jangga Group, the food conglomerate that ruined his life, by opening his own pub, DanBam, in the vibrant district of Itaewon. 🌟 Key Elements
